Safety and security
Pet dog parks and canine daycare are both wonderful rooms for dogs to exercise and mingle, however they vary in safety functions. Pet dog park environments are uncertain, and a bad experience can have long-lasting results on your dog's self-confidence and behavior.
Pet dog childcare provides a secure and structured atmosphere, where canines are positioned in groups that match their personalities. The facility has actually experienced personnel that keep an eye on play to avoid injuries. Although fights do occur occasionally, they are generally minor and are not a result of hostility.
Another safety function of pet dog day care is that workers are in charge of applying regulations and ensuring that animals are vaccinated. This is essential because dogs in unsupervised environments might be revealed to virus in feces or alcohol consumption water, and this can cause illness like kennel cough, giardia, fleas, and other parasites. They might additionally be subjected to aggressive canines, which can cause serious harm to pups and young people.
Socializing
Canine parks use the best off-leash atmosphere for canines to release energy and fraternize various other animals. They also provide a great place for pets to work out, which is an integral part of their total health and wellness. Canine daycares, on the other hand, supply an extra structured and safe setting for your family pet to communicate with other pets in a much more controlled fashion.
Canines that are not exposed to various other pet dogs in a favorable way on a regular basis may develop anti-social habits which can show up as fear, stress and anxiety or aggressiveness towards other animals. Pet dogs that hang around at the dog park typically just recognize one setting of interaction with various other pets-- high drive play until they are exhausted.
When dogs satisfy at a pet dog park, the introductions are generally frenzied with each pet dog hurrying to reach the other. This can lead to scuffles or fights. At a well-run day care, very first introductions are commonly sniffing butts and the workers stay in control of the interaction making sure no scuffles take place.

Atmosphere
Pet parks use outdoor play in an all-natural setting, which gives workout and possibilities for pet dogs to engage in their all-natural behaviors like smelling and running. This can help reduce anxiousness, promote socializing, and improve psychological stimulation.
However, exterior play spaces are prone to disease-spreading problems such as diarrhea and Giardia as a result of direct get in touch with between pets. Additionally, the atmosphere might not be clean adequate to prevent contamination from pets' feces or urine.
At day care, the facilities are cleaned up regularly and sterilized regularly to reduce these threats. Furthermore, specialist daycares separate pets based on dimension, personality, and playing style to stop dangerous interactions.
